"What is Maha? It means 'great'. The capacity of the mind is as great as that of space. It is infinite, neither round nor square, neither great nor small, neither green nor yellow, neither red nor white, neither above nor below, neither long nor short, neither angry nor happy, neither right nor wrong, neither good nor evil, neither first nor last. All Buddha-Lands are as empty as space. Intrinsically our transcendental nature is empty and not a single dharma (thing, phenomena) [teaching or truth] can be attained. It is the same with the Essence of Mind, which is a state of 'Absolute Emptiness' (i.e., the Emptiness of Form). "
~ Hui-Neng

"We say that the Essence of Mind is great [Maha] because it embraces all things, since all things are within our nature. When we see the goodness or the badness of other people we are not attracted by it, nor repelled by it, nor attached to it; so that our attitude of mind is as empty as space. In this way, we say our mind is great. Therefore we call it "Maha" [or Great]."
~ Hui-Neng
